In this ongoing class students will learn about a new animal each week! Students will learn the physical characteristics, diet, habitat and interesting facts about different animals. This class is perfect for students who love to learn about different animals. Students will learn about the animal through games, pictures and videos. Students will also discuss if they would like to have this animal as a pet or not based on the facts we learned in the class. Some animals we will learn about are koalas, llamas, sloths, zebras, reindeer, lions, flamingos, polar bears, penguins and many more! Students will also get a coloring sheet of the animal to color during class.
